Output 740a8f3c56386eb762eebf9eb4ddc9e869dd26db4165ae2c4aec4b7eca95d7ad:1

value
16438000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296176d4017801f3b91fe174878b7056847edf88 OP_EQUAL
address
MBfxhDyzw8DcQjp1aNgF9oVRk336stHue2
transaction
740a8f3c56386eb762eebf9eb4ddc9e869dd26db4165ae2c4aec4b7eca95d7ad
spent
true